Understanding Adult ADHD: Comprehensive Guide to Adult ADHD Tests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is not confined to childhood; many adults continue to experience symptoms that impact their lives. While ADHD has historically been perceived as a youth condition, it is now extensively acknowledged that it can continue into the adult years, frequently undiagnosed. For those who suspect they may have ADHD, adult ADHD testing can supply valuable insights and cause effective management techniques. This article explores the procedure of adult ADHD testing, its importance, and typical FAQs connected with the diagnosis.
  2.  What is Adult ADHD? AD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ition that impacts both children and adults. It is characterized by a consistent pattern of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that hinders working or advancement. For adults, ADHD can manifest in numerous methods, including:
  3.  Difficulty focusing and following through on jobs Chronic disorganization and forgetfulness Impulsivity in decision-making Emotional dysregulation Concerns with relationships or work efficiency Acknowledging the symptoms and seeking a proper diagnosis is essential for enhancing lifestyle.
  4.  Why is Testing Important? Testing for adult ADHD is vital for a number of reasons:
  5.  Accurate Diagnosis: Symptoms often overlap with other mental health conditions such as anxiety and depression. Testing helps separate in between them.
  6.  Customized Treatment: Understanding the seriousness and particular symptoms can result in targeted treatment techniques, including treatment, medication, or lifestyle adjustments.
  7.  Improved Quality of Life: Untreated ADHD can lead to significant obstacles in personal, academic, and professional settings. A correct diagnosis encourages individuals to seek the assistance they need.
  8.  The Adult ADHD Testing Process The adult ADHD assessment normally includes a combination of steps, which may consist of:
  9.  1. Preliminary Screening A lot of evaluations begin with a preliminary screening survey. These casual tools can assist suggest the existence of ADHD symptoms, such as:
  10.  Difficulty sustaining attention Disorganization in day-to-day jobs Problem with time management 2. Clinical Interview After the screening, a certified mental health professional will carry out a clinical interview. During this session, they will explore:
  11.  Personal and household history of ADHD or related conditions Evaluation of school records and previous symptoms Conversations of existing obstacles in different aspects of life, including work and relationships 3. Standardized Testing If ADHD is believed, the clinician might also utilize standardized tests such as:
  12.  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S): A common screening tool that examines symptoms based upon ADHD requirements. Conners' Adult ADHD Rating Scales: Measures how ADHD symptoms impact day-to-day performance. 4. Additional Assessments In some cases, even more evaluations might be advised to examine existing together conditions such as anxiety, anxiety, or learning impairments.
  13.  5. Medical diagnosis Based upon the info gathered, the psychological health specialist will identify whether a medical diagnosis of ADHD is appropriate. They might classify it based upon one of the following discussions:
  14.  Predominantly Inattentive Presentation Mainly Hyperactive-Impulsive Presentation Integrated Presentation 6. Treatment Plan If diagnosed, the clinician will deal with the private to develop a treatment strategy customized to their particular requirements. This may consist of medication, cognitive-behavioral therapy, way of life modifications, or a combination thereof.

Here are some reliable methods:
  16.  Medication Management: Stimulant medications like methylphenidate and amphetamines are commonly prescribed, but non-stimulant alternatives are likewise readily available. Therapy or Therapy: Therapeutic approaches,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), can help people develop coping strategies and organizational abilities. Skills Training: Practical training in time management, organization, and productivity can significantly enhance daily working. Support system: Connecting with others who have ADHD can supply emotional support and shared strategies. Often Asked Questions (FAQs) 1. Can I have ADHD as an adult even if I was never detected as a child?Yes, numerous adults are detected with ADHD later in life, frequently when they start discovering ongoing symptoms impacting their daily performance. 2. What are the most common symptoms of adult
  17.  ADHD?The most typical symptoms consist of negligence, poor organization, impulsivity, uneasyness, and difficulty handling feelings. 3. How is adult ADHD various from youth ADHD?While the core symptoms remain the exact same, adult ADHD often manifests differently, with symptoms being less noticeable(e.g., internal uneasyness instead of hyperactivity). 4. What's the initial step if I believe I have ADHD?The very first step is to speak with a health care expert focusing on ADHD for a thorough assessment.
  18.  5. Is medication the only choice for treating adult ADHD?No, medication is
  19. one choice. Behavioral treatment, lifestyle changes, and coaching can likewise work in managing symptoms.
